Description

Dale is a fully wind and waterproof jacket with taped seams that is made from breathable fabric. It has four front pockets and one inside pocket. The two-way zip helps to provide good ventilation. The hood is adjustable and a high collar protects against wind and snow. The hood, hem and cuffs can all be adjusted as needed. The lining has been dyed using a solution dyeing technique. This technique saves up to 80% water compared to conventionally dyed fabric in the same material. PFC-free water-repellent finish.

  • Water Column: 10,000mm
  • Breathability: 8,000 g/m²/24h
  • Padding: 100 g/m²
  • Material: 100% Polyester

Model: 187 cm tall, wearing size M
